What is Verizon 5G setup?
Verizon 5G setup is an alternative to traditional broadband connections. Unlike traditional internet plans that use coaxial cables or fiber-optic lines, Verizon 5G network uses radio waves to deliver high-speed internet to homes. The network relies on a small device called a 5G router, which receives 5G signals from nearby cell towers and broadcasts them to devices in the home, allowing you to access high-speed internet without the need for a wired connection.
How fast is Verizon 5G?
According to Verizon, 5G network speeds can reach up to 1 Gbps, which is 10 times faster than the average US broadband speed. This means you can download large files, stream 4K videos, play online games, and video chat with multiple people without buffering or lagging issues. However, the actual speed may vary depending on the location, the number of devices connected to the network, and other factors.

Device compatibility
Using Verizon's 5G network requires a compatible device. Most modern smartphones support 5G, but you will need a 5G router to use the network for your home internet. Verizon offers its own 5G router (the Verizon 5G Home router) for $399.99 or $13.33 per month for 24 months. The router supports up to 30 devices and has a range of up to 2,500 square feet.
